Overview

Start an exciting new chapter in your hospitality career at Upstairs at the Grill

Join us as a Chef De Partie and we can offer you a package of up to £12.51 per hour plus up to £4.00 per hour in Tip Jar!

We’re looking for a Chef De Partie to join our passionate brigade of food enthusiasts. You will be working as part of our team to deliver an authentic fresh food-based menu in one of the busiest Manhattan style steak houses in town. Immersed in the history of one of Chester’s iconic buildings on Watergate Street, we balance tradition with the contemporary for a truly unique dining experience. It’s a story of great steaks, classic cocktails, fine wine and unparalleled service delivered in elegant & relaxed surroundings.

As a Chef De Partie, we can take you on the journey to Head Chef for those that have ambition and provide a company culture that really cares and embraces work life balance.

Benefits

  • Earn up to £4.00 per hour on top of your hourly pay with our epic Tip Jar incentive!
  • 25% discount for you and 5 friends at all of our restaurants (including Hickory\’s Smokehouse & Upstairs at the Grill). This will increase to 50% discount for loyal service.
  • Birthday reward – A meal on us for you and your friends every year
  • Superb training & progression opportunities
  • Free Team food while on shift
  • Paid occasion days off (Wedding Day, Kid’s first day at school, Moving into your first house and more!)
  • The Red Zone – Our pledge to work life balance.
  • Enhanced paternity and maternity pay
  • Up to £1000 refer a friend scheme.
  • Chance to \’give a bit back\’ by joining our fundraising activities for Cash for Kids
  • Stacks of enrichment opportunities including the possibility of once in a lifetime trips! Including research trips to the best bars in London, winery trips to Italy, Spain & France, distillery trips to Sweden, and many more.

How to prepare for a job interview at Upstairs at the Grill

✨Show Your Passion for Food

As a Chef de Partie, it's crucial to demonstrate your enthusiasm for cooking and food. Share your experiences with different cuisines, techniques, or dishes that inspire you. This will show the interviewers that you're not just looking for a job, but that you genuinely care about the culinary arts.

✨Know the Menu

Familiarise yourself with the restaurant's menu before the interview. Being able to discuss specific dishes, ingredients, and cooking methods will impress the interviewers and show that you're proactive and genuinely interested in their establishment.

✨Highlight Teamwork Skills

Working as part of a brigade is essential in a busy kitchen. Be prepared to discuss your previous experiences in team settings, how you handle conflicts, and how you contribute to a positive work environment. This will demonstrate that you can thrive in a collaborative atmosphere.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some insightful questions to ask at the end of your interview.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or the restaurant's future plans. This shows that you're engaged and thinking about your long-term fit within the company.
